Hayward Holdings Inc. (NYSE "HAYW") is the largest manufacturer of residential swimming pool equipment in the world, with a significant presence in the commercial pool market that is continuously growing. Hayward designs, manufactures, and markets a full line of residential and commercial pool and spa equipment including pumps, filters, heating, cleaners, salt chlorinators, automation, lighting, safety, flow control and energy solutions at our company owned facilities. Headquartered in Charlotte, North Carolina, Hayward also has facilities in Tennessee, Arizona, and Rhode Island as well as Canada, Spain, France, Australia, and China.
